Perham's Economic Landscape and Growth Drivers

Perham's appeal as an investment destination is deeply rooted in its strong and diversified local economy. Unlike markets overly reliant on a single industry, Perham benefits from a balanced economic base that contributes to steady growth and reduced volatility.

Demographic Trends and Local Economy

Perham has experienced consistent population growth, albeit at a measured pace, which is a key indicator of a healthy and expanding community. Data from the U.S. Census Bureau indicates a steady increase, driven by both natural growth and an influx of new residents attracted by employment opportunities and lifestyle. The local economy is bolstered by strong sectors including healthcare, manufacturing, and a burgeoning tourism industry, particularly around the region's numerous lakes. Perham Health, for instance, stands as a major employer, providing stable, high-quality jobs that support a robust housing market. Manufacturing firms also contribute significantly to the local employment rate, which consistently outperforms state averages, signaling a strong job market and consumer confidence. This economic resilience fosters a stable environment for real estate values and rental demand.

Real Estate Market Performance and Investment Opportunities

Residential Market Analysis

The residential sector in Perham has shown consistent appreciation, reflecting strong demand and limited inventory. Over the past five years, average home values in Perham have seen an annual appreciation rate of approximately 5-7%, outperforming some larger regional markets. This growth is driven by the stable local economy, attractive quality of life, and the region's appeal for both primary residences and seasonal homes. Median home prices remain relatively accessible compared to metropolitan areas, offering a lower barrier to entry for investors. Inventory levels, while fluctuating, generally favor sellers, indicating sustained buyer interest. Rental vacancy rates for single-family homes and multi-family units are typically low, often below 3%, suggesting a healthy demand for rental properties and strong potential for consistent rental income. This makes Perham an attractive market for buy-and-hold strategies, particularly for properties targeting families or professionals working in the area.

Commercial and Rental Market Prospects

The commercial real estate market in Perham, while smaller in scale, presents niche opportunities. Retail spaces in the downtown area benefit from local consumer spending and tourist traffic. Light industrial properties, supported by the manufacturing sector, also demonstrate stability. For residential investors, the rental market is particularly robust. Given the strong employment base and the appeal of the area, many residents, including new employees at Perham Health or those seeking temporary housing, opt for rentals. This creates a favorable environment for investors in multi-family units or single-family rental homes. Furthermore, the proximity to popular recreational areas like Big Pine Lake also fuels demand for short-term rentals, especially during peak seasons, offering diversified income streams for properties strategically located to leverage this tourism.

Future Outlook and Risk Assessment

The long-term outlook for Perham's real estate market remains positive, supported by its diversified economy and commitment to community development. Continued investment in infrastructure, education, and healthcare facilities is expected to sustain demand. However, like any market, risks exist. These include potential interest rate fluctuations impacting affordability, or broader economic downturns. Mitigating these risks involves thorough financial planning, maintaining a diversified portfolio, and staying informed on local economic indicators. The relatively stable nature of the Perham market, coupled with its strong community engagement, suggests a lower risk profile compared to more volatile, rapidly expanding urban centers, making it an attractive option for investors seeking steady, long-term growth.
